Quick Facts — West Miami city

What is the median household income in West Miami city?
The median household income in West Miami city is $56,509 (U.S. Census Bureau ACS 5-Year Estimates, 2023).
What is the poverty rate in West Miami city?
The poverty rate in West Miami city is 13.3% (U.S. Census Bureau ACS 2023).
What is the median home value in West Miami city?
$436,700 (U.S. Census Bureau ACS 2023).
What is the average rent in West Miami city?
The median gross rent in West Miami city is $2,176 per month (U.S. Census Bureau ACS 2023).
What percentage of West Miami city residents have a college degree?
34.6% of adults in West Miami city hold a bachelor's degree or higher (U.S. Census Bureau ACS 2023).
